According to The Hollywood Reporter, The CW has picked up at least the first six produced episodes of "The L. A. Complex" for a summer run.

http://www.hollywoodreporter.com/live-feed/cw-la-complex-summer-278749

Even though Jewel is not mentioned in that article, she is in the accompanying picture, and IMDb.com lists her as Raquel in all six of those episodes. The show begins airing in Canada next week.
